Subject: Quickstore 4.2 — bloom filter now fronts the KV layer

Plugin authors: starting with this release, Quickstore places a bloom filter ahead of the key-value store. Negative lookups return faster; false positives fall through safely. No API changes are required on your side. Verify your plugin against the staging build referenced below.

session token of fahif-tadup = htk3_9c7

## Runbook: Account Recovery — Receipt Mailer

Reviewer note: the Glowfinch donation-receipt mailer uses a dedicated service account. If that account locks after repeated auth failures, pause the send queue first, then initiate recovery through the Ashgrove console. The recovery flow prompts once for the passphrase, which is recorded directly below.

vault phrase of tajop-haduf = holath-brivan-wenax

## Support

Clock skew between Hollowbeam build agents causes spurious cache misses and out-of-order artifact timestamps. All agents must sync against the internal Timberline NTP pool; drift over 500ms fails the preflight check. See docs/skew.md for diagnosis steps. If an agent repeatedly fails sync, file a ticket and contact the build infrastructure team.

pager mailbox: druwyn@norvaio.corp

Handover: bounce processor (Mailwright). Cron runs every 5 min, parses DSN codes, flags hard bounces, suppresses after 3 soft. Dead-letter queue drains nightly — don't touch it manually. Deploys go through Ferro's pipeline; ask Tove if it stalls. Logs rotate weekly. If the suppression store gets corrupted, restore from the sealed vault snapshot using the recovery passphrase below.

vault phrase of bagaf-kajeg = jorath-feniel-briir-siliel-ralix

Scope: nightly rebalancing planner for the Caldwick bike-share fleet. Verify: (a) station capacity table refreshed within 24h; (b) truck-route solver timeout set to 90s, no silent fallbacks; (c) demand-forecast model version pinned and logged per run; (d) manual override actions recorded with timestamps. Finding: override audit log gaps on two dates, now backfilled. Remediation: log write moved ahead of plan commit. Re-check next quarter. Accountability for this control rests with the individual identified below.

approver of kadug-fajop = Zorael Ulaox Kasvan Casir